Muffy, if you can book a PS in advance, that is wonderful. However, if you can’t, try not to fret too much. My family and guests did not have an advance PS reservation last NYE (none of us could decide ahead of time what we wanted to do that day). We entered Epcot in the late morning on NYE and I walked up to a CM in one of the gift shops. I asked her how I should go about making a PS reservation for later on that day. She picked up her telephone, dialed a number, and then handed me the phone. Since my sister had suddenly decided that we should dine at
L'Originale Alfredo di Roma Ristorante in Italy, I asked the person on the phone what was available at that restaurant for later on that day. I was given a choice of seating times and I selected one (I should note that there were seven in my party and yet we had lots of seating times to choose from). Later on that day we showed up for our meal in Italy and had a wonderful time.
 
By the way, the menu was the same, as were the prices. Nothing was increased for the holiday.

If you make a PS on NYE they will ask for a CC to charge if you don't show up. I think this is a new practice, at least for holidays. I think also you have to cancel 48 hours prior to the PS are you will be charged $10.00 per person. Maybe people were making PS and then not showing up.
 
You are correct, adisneynut, CC required and a 10.00 charge if a no show.
